> Log:
> s/LLVM_SHOULD_RETURN_STRUCT_AS_SCALAR/ 
> LLVM_SHOULD_RETURN_SELT_STRUCT_AS_SCALAR/g

I don't like this one.  Structs that are returned as scalars are not,  
in fact, always single-element.
